Atlanta Communities: Buford
This town was named after Col. A.S. Buford who was a railroad president. In earlier days, the city of Buford was recognized as the central location for leather making. One of the most popular places to visit in Buford is the Lanier Museum of Natural History. This museum is focused on the education and preservation of northern Georgia's natural history. One can see all kind of animals and plant life that are relevant to northern Georgia on display. Different classes and programs are also offered for both children and adults. Location
Buford is just 50 miles north east of Atlanta and is located in Gwinnett County. Just an hour north of Buford is the international city of Atlanta. Home to over 4 million people, Atlanta has much to offer in the area of education, employment and entertainment. Atlanta offers an array of shopping opportunities such as the "Underground", serving as a popular souvenir headquarters. Also the World of Coke-a-Cola museum brings Coke enthusiasts from all over to explore the world of Coke.
